Maybe this explains why colored fog won't work, from a theater web page....

Belief #2 -- Adding dye or food coloring to fog fluid will produce colored fog.

To understand why this is not true, consider this riddle when snow melts, where does the white go? Is snow white because it's had white paint added to it? Of course not! Snow appears white because the ice crystals reflect back all the light striking them, in most cases that light is the "white" light of the sun. Likewise, the droplets of glycol in a cloud of fog reflect back all the light striking them. The way to add color to a cloud of fog then is simply to change the color of light striking it. If the fog is only being lit with a red spotlight, red is the only color it can reflect back. Adding dye to your fog fluid will produce some interesting effects; however, ruining the fog machine and voiding the warranty will unfortunately be among them.
